Introduction to Lincoln Financial Field
Located in Philadelphia, Lincoln Financial Field, also known as "The Linc," is a state-of-the-art stadium that has been the home of the Philadelphia Eagles since 2003. With a seating capacity of over 69,000, it's an ideal venue for large-scale events like concerts, football games, and - as we're about to explore - international soccer matches. But what makes Lincoln Financial Field so special, and why is it an attractive location for FIFA events?
One of the key factors that sets Lincoln Financial Field apart is its cutting-edge design and amenities. From its impressive turf field to its top-notch sound system, every detail has been carefully considered to provide an exceptional experience for players and spectators alike. A Brief History of FIFA and Lincoln Financial Field
While Lincoln Financial Field has primarily been used for American football games, it has also hosted several high-profile soccer matches over the years, including international friendlies and CONCACAF Gold Cup games. These events have not only demonstrated the stadium's versatility but also its potential to host larger, more prestigious tournaments - like FIFA World Cup qualifiers or even the Copa America.
